Delta launches automatic check-in through app

Delta Air Lines has added automatic check-in to the Fly Delta app to streamline the check-in experience for customers and take the guesswork out of accessing a boarding pass. The new functionality, available on the latest version of the app, automatically checks in eligible customers 24 hours prior to their scheduled departure.

Delta Air Lines revenues hit by Hurricane Irma impact

11 October 2017 Airline News

Delta Air Lines has reported adjusted pre-tax income for the September 2017 quarter of $1.7 billion, a $182 million decrease from the same period last year. Pre-tax income includes a $120 million reduction from the operational disruption following Hurricane Irma that hit the Caribbean, Florida, Georgia and, specifically, Delta’s hub in Atlanta.

Delta Air Lines launches video chat reservations service

Delta Air Lines’ latest innovative test program at Ronald Reagan Washington National Airport allows customers to video chat from the airport with a specialist – a first for US-based airlines. Five interactive digital screens with individual receivers are now featured at the redesigned Delta Sky Assist so customers can connect face-to-face with Delta specialists.

Delta Air Lines takes stake in Air France-KLM

31 July 2017 Airline News

Delta Air Lines is deepening its longstanding and industry-leading partnership with Air France-KLM Group with a €375 million investment to acquire ten per cent equity in the joint venture partner and a seat on the Air France-KLM Group board.
